Appointment/Receptionist Manager
Position Summary
Supervise Graduate Clinic Coordinators (Periodontics, Oral Surgery, AEGD) ADP Coordinator, Pediatric Coordinator, Telecommunication, and Reception.
Essential Duties and Responsibilities
Supervising the Telecommunications:
- Monitor patient calls to assure patients are greeted in a friendly and professional manner.
- Monitor patient calls to confirm patients are receiving accurate information.
- Assure appointments are scheduled correctly with the provider and clinic.
- Assure staff is correcting patient information based on reports (patient unsubscribed and blank or incorrect number) provided by Easy Market.
- Ensure staff is following script when scheduling screening appointments.
- Assure staff is following protocol for pre-registration and the patient information is accurate.
Supervising the Reception:
- Assure patients and visitors are greeted in a friendly and professional manner.
- Assure patients of record are encouraged to use Kiosk for check-in.
- Assure patients are receiving accurate information.
- Assure staff is following protocol for new patient’s appointments.
Supervising Staff:
- Ensure staff is following the Dental Center attendance policy.
- Ensure there is adequate coverage for daily operations in the coordinator clinics, telecommunications, and reception areas.
- Hire, train, discipline and dismiss staff as necessary.
- Review and approve time cards.
Supervising Coordinators:
- Assure patients and visitors are greeted in a friendly and professional manner.
- Assure patients appointments are scheduled accurately.
- Assure patients calls are returned in a timely manner.
- Assure patients are signing treatment plans before treatment and receiving accurate information related to their planned treatment.
Administrative Responsibilities:
- Assist with schedules (Graduate Clinics, Emergency, and Screening).
- Medical consults for clinics (Graduate and Undergraduate Clinics).
- Assist with the financial staff when needed.
